从mac ssh到linux服务器运行Grads以及X11

 


  从mac上ssh到linux服务器后运行Grads,图形显示到本地mac上老是不成功。出错提示


Error in GXSTRT: Unable to connect to X server


  找了好多信息,有的说改环境变量,有的要启用X11所有用户的访问权限"xhost +",还有什么启用mac上的TCP 侦听。最后都没搞定。最后在macosxhints.com上找到了答案,非常简单的只是把ssh命令用好就行了...


you just run ssh -X ... from Terminal.
You don't need to set DISPLAY variable.
And "ssh -Y" works well between Macs running Leopard or Tiger either way, or from a Mac/Leopard to Linux

总的来说就是先开X11,然后ssh -X -Y (server IP)就可以了。


ZOC中可以点开Home Directory->选中你的连接->点edit->点session profile右侧的edit->选device->选择secure shell->点advanced SSH Settings->把Enable X11 connection forwarding选上,然后运行这个连接,再运行grads就可以了


 

Comments

Popular posts from this blog

Nvidia Shield TV 2017 国行直接刷美版8.01固件

openwrt路由器忘记IP或端口等无法登录的解决方法

1945年南京受降式的场馆竟然不开放!